What is the best ways to defrost meat?

The best ways to defrost meat are:

1. Refrigerator thawing: Place the frozen meat in the refrigerator and allow it to thaw slowly overnight or for several days. This is the safest method and preserves the meat's quality best.

2. Cold water thawing: Submerge the frozen meat in a bowl or sink filled with cold water. Change the water every 30 minutes to ensure it continues to thaw evenly. Ensure that the meat remains completely submerged in the water.

3. Microwave thawing: Use the microwave's defrost setting if you are in a hurry. However, be sure to cook the meat immediately afterwards, as microwaving can quickly heat the meat's surface while leaving the interior still frozen.

Important tips for defrosting meat safely:

- Never leave meat at room temperature to defrost, as this can encourage the growth of harmful bacteria.

- Always make sure that meat is fully defrosted before cooking it, as partially frozen meat can be more difficult to cook evenly.
